@font-face{font-family:Balford;src:url(/cdn/shop/files/Balford.woff2?v=1761131282) format("woff2");font-weight:400;font-style:normal;font-display:swap}.bottom--footer---links li a{font-weight:400!important}.menu-legal{display:flex;margin-left:0;margin-bottom:0}.menu-legal li{list-style:none;padding:0}.menu-legal li a{font-weight:400!important;font-size:13px;padding-right:15px;position:relative}.menu-legal>li:nth-of-type(1){margin-right:10px}.menu-legal>li:nth-of-type(1) a:after{position:absolute;right:0;content:"|";top:-3px}.copyright--desktop{display:flex!important;justify-content:space-between!important;align-items:center}.bottom--footer-row,.bottom--footer---localization{width:100%}.footer-main>div{display:flex!important;gap:10px!important}.links-footer a{font-size:15px!important;font-weight:200!important}.section-description p{font-size:22px!important;line-height:1.2;margin-top:15px}.section-title--wrapper .section-description{max-width:100%}.blog-post-card__title a{font-size:22px;margin-top:10px!important;display:block;line-height:1.2}@media screen and (max-width:767px){h1{font-size:50px!important}.hero-video--text-content .hero-video--text-title h2.homepage-sections--title{font-size:60px!important}.hero-video--text-content .hero-video--text-subtitle p,p,.section-description p{font-size:18px!important}h2{font-size:50px!important}.wrapper-spacing--h{padding-left:25px;padding-right:25px}.image-with-text-overlay__text--position-mobile-center{padding-top:50px!important;padding-bottom:65px!important}.image-with-text-overlay__mobile-image--original{height:100%}.image-with-text-overlay__grid--foreground{padding:50px 25px!important}.footer-main>div>.links-footer:nth-of-type(2) .footer-content{flex-direction:column!important;gap:5px!important;margin-top:20px}.footer-bottom--inner{padding-top:20px!important}.container-blog{padding-left:25px!important;padding-right:25px!important}.contenido-blog{padding-top:50px!important}.destacado-blog{margin-top:50px!important;padding:50px 25px!important}.template-article__previous{padding-left:20px!important}.template-article__next{padding-right:20px!important}.contenido-blog{padding-bottom:25px!important}.mobile-nav__item:after{opacity:0}.mobile-nav__logo-title--inner{border-bottom:none!important}.mobile-nav--footer .locale--mobile{display:none!important}form p{font-size:16px!important;font-weight:400!important}.section-contact-form--submit-wrapper{display:flex;flex-direction:column;justify-content:center;align-items:center}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/custom.css.map */
